Avicularia is a genus of the family Theraphosidae containing various species of tarantulas. The genus is native to tropical South America. Each species in the genus has very distinguishable pink foot pads. One of the most notable features of the Avicularia species is their odd method of defense.


Specimen size 3"

Avicularia avicularia

